🛳️ Modern cruising is not what you think


Let’s bust some myths right now:



  • “Cruises are only for seniors.”
    Not anymore. Today’s cruises offer adults-only options, vibrant nightlife, fitness classes, stylish lounges, and entertainment that rivals Broadway. You’ll find couples, friend groups, solo travelers, and multi-generational families all onboard—because cruise lines have evolved to meet everyone’s needs.


  • “I don’t want to feel trapped or overcrowded.”
    You won’t. Many mid-sized and specialty ships are designed with space, serenity, and luxury in mind. Think stylish staterooms with ocean views, open-air decks, quiet corners, and plenty of elbow room—no neon lights or screaming kids required.


  • “It’s all buffets and bingo.”
    Nope. Expect globally inspired fine dining (often themed to match your route), chic cocktail bars, cultural performances, culinary classes, and full-service spas. And yes, still plenty of chances to relax in stretchy pants with a glass of wine and an ocean view.

Enter the Luka Duffle by Calpak — the unicorn of carry-ons. My daughter actually had it first, and I have been envious ever since. That girl dragged her Luka back and forth across the country traveling for work (and fun!) and it still is in perfect shape. That’s when I knew I had to have one. When I saw it mentioned in a traveler forum, I started my deep dive into reviews, and finally decided to get my own. It’s the perfect color for me, a light, dreamy lavender. A few trips later, it’s safe to say I’m obsessed. It’s stylish without being flashy, soft without feeling flimsy, and functional in all the right ways. 💡 What Makes the Luka Duffl e So Great f you’ve ever tried to shove a week’s worth of “just in case” outfits into your under-seat bag, you’ll understand the beauty of this design. Here’s why the Luka has become my go-to for everything from Caribbean vacations to weekend getaways: Lightweight, soft exterior: That signature puffed nylon fabric somehow looks chic and feels like a cloud. Smart compartments: A separate shoe pocket (hallelujah), interior zip sections, and a padded sleeve for your laptop or tablet. Did I mention: So. Many. Compartments. Trolley sleeve: Slides perfectly over your suitcase handle — no more juggling coffee, boarding pass, and bag straps in the security line. Extra-big exterior cup holder: even holds an Owala. Under-seat fit: It passes the dreaded “personal item test” on most airlines while holding a shocking amount. Colors for every vibe: From classic black to that gorgeous blush tone that gives “effortlessly put-together traveler.” They also offered limited edition colors and materials such as metallic tones. Adequately cushioned straps: Comfortable shoulder straps that are just the right length. Need I say more! It’s the rare bag that makes me feel both organized and a little fabulous.
